2017-04-24 5 views
0

私はラクダルートのためにJunitを書いています。ルートはjson入力を受け入れます。サービスは正常に構築され、インストールされています。私はkarafにJsonPathバンドルをインストールしましたが、私はJunitを実行しているときに以下の例外を受け取ります。コンパイルとしてmavenの依存関係を指定しました。Junos in Jboss fuse:依存関係を待っています

<dependency> 
    <groupId>com.jayway.jsonpath</groupId> 
    <artifactId>json-path</artifactId> 
    <version>1.2.0</version> 
    <scope>compile</scope> 
</dependency> 

例外メッセージ:バンドルテストの依存関係を待って

[(= jsonpath &(言語)(オブジェクトクラス= org.apache.camel.spi.LanguageResolver))]

答えて

0

私は問題がCamelテストにあると思います。あなたがソースを提供すれば、おそらく私たちはあなたにいくつかのアイデアを与えることができます。

「いいかげんにラクラクテストを書くには」の参考に、公式のレポを確認することができます。

https://github.com/apache/camel/tree/master/components/camel-jsonpath/src/test/java/org/apache/camel/jsonpath

+0

私がポンポンでラクダJsonPath依存性を見逃しているので、問題がある:私はあなたにjsonPathコンポーネントのテストへのリンクを添付しています。ちょうどそれを追加し、正常に動作します。 – Jay

関連する問題